Abstract: In real Hilbert spaces, we construct a new algorithm to find a common solution of the split feasibility problem and the fixed points problem involving a finite family of quasi-nonexpansive mappings. Under appropriate conditions, it is proved that the iteration sequence by the algorithm strongly converges to a common solution of the split feasibility problem and the fixed points problem by using the demi-closed principle and properties of projection operators and conjugate operators. The effectiveness of the algorithm is verified by numerical experiments. The results of this paper improve and extend recent some relative results.
